Job Summary

Beijing-based role leading the licensing and distribution of Sony Pictures Television content across China and Mongolia. Drive revenue by executing the business strategy, identifying new opportunities, managing end-to-end licensing and negotiations, and coordinating with Marketing, Sales Planning, Finance, Legal, and Research to optimize performance and expand local and international distribution.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Execute the business strategy and manage content sales and distribution across all media platforms in China and Mongolia, maximizing revenue opportunities for SPT’s content portfolio.
  • •Identify and pursue new business opportunities, partnerships, and distribution channels to drive incremental revenue growth.
  • •Manage the end-to-end content licensing process, including deal modeling and valuation, commercial negotiations, internal approvals, contract execution, and ongoing client management.
  • •Build and maintain strong client relationships, developing a deep understanding of clients’ business objectives, strategies, and market challenges.
  • •Collaborate with the Marketing team to plan and implement promotional campaigns aimed at enhancing the content performance on the clients’ platforms.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Marketing, Media, or a related discipline.
  • •Typically a minimum of 5 years of experience in content sales, content acquisition, and/or account management within the entertainment and media industry.
  • •Proven track record in negotiating, structuring, and managing content licensing agreements.
  • •Strong understanding of the China media landscape, including both traditional linear television and digital streaming platforms.
  • •Demonstrated customer-centric mindset with excellent relationship management, stakeholder engagement, and negotiation skills.
